Description

4-Hydrazino-8-Methylquinoline Hydrochloride is a specialized quinoline derivative that serves as a critical building block in advanced organic synthesis. This compound matters for its role as a versatile hydrazine-containing intermediate, enabling the construction of complex heterocyclic frameworks. It is primarily needed by researchers and manufacturers in the pharmaceutical and agrochemical industries for developing new active ingredients and functional materials.

Basic Information

Product Name 4-Hydrazino-8-Methylquinoline Hydrochloride
CAS No. 1172746-47-2
Molecular Formula C₁₀H₁₁N₃·HCl
Molecular Weight 209.68 g/mol
Synonyms 8-Methyl-4-hydrazinylquinoline hydrochloride; 4-Hydrazinyl-8-methylquinoline hydrochloride; 4-Hydrazino-8-methylquinoline HCl; 8-Methylquinoline-4-hydrazine hydrochloride; Quinoline, 4-hydrazino-8-methyl-, hydrochloride; 1172746-47-2; 4-Hydrazino-8-methylquinoline monohydrochloride

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ed after opening to prevent degradation from atmospheric moisture.
